A superseded Standard is one, which is fully replaced by another Standard, which is a new edition of the same Standard.
RADIO EQUIPMENT AND SYSTEMS (RES) - FLOAT-FREE MARITIME SATELLITE EMERGENCY POSITION INDICATING RADIO BEACONS (EPIRBS) OPERATING ON 406,025 MHZ - TECHNICAL CHARACTERISTICS AND METHODS OF MEASUREMENT

States the minimum requirements for maritime float-free satellite Emergency Position-Indicating Radio Beacons (EPIRBs) operating on 406,025 MHz, with release mechanism, operating in the COSPAS-SARSAT system.
